That’s right. I do. Of course, this may be due to my lack of knowledge of Android, but here’s what I see: Windows Mobile used to be friggin’ hot. It more or less SAVED a lot of us who needed our phones to do more than just being phones. But it had a flaw I think is fatal (apart from its obvious staleness): MS made the various O/S versions, released them to OEMs. OEMs modified as needed, effectively creating a large number of vendor specific customized Windows Mobile versions.
